Ravi Shastri Honored with Stand at Wankhede Stadium

Former Indian cricketer and coach Ravi Shastri expressed deep gratitude as a stand at the iconic Wankhede Stadium was named after him. The Mumbai Cricket Association honored cricketing stalwarts, including Shastri, Dilip Sardesai, Eknath Solkar, and Diana Edulji, for their contributions to Mumbai and Indian cricket. The Level 1 stand below the press box is now known as the Ravi Shastri Stand, recognizing his significant role in Indian cricket.

Honored by this gesture, Shastri referred to Wankhede as his “karmabhoomi,” where his cricketing journey began. Maharashtra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is unveiled the honors, with stadium gates dedicated to other cricketing legends. Gate No. 3, Gate No. 6, and Gate No. 5 were renamed after Dilip Sardesai, Eknath Solkar, and Diana Edulji, respectively, acknowledging their contributions to Mumbai cricket.

Shastri expressed his gratitude to the Maharashtra Chief Minister, MCA officials, and the cricketing fraternity for the honor. The ceremony, attended by notable figures like Sunil Gavaskar and Dilip Vengsarkar, celebrated the legacy of these cricketing icons at the Wankhede Stadium.
